So installieren Sie Webmin auf CentOS 7

Zu den vielfältigen Aufgaben und Rollen, die wir im IT-Bereich ausführen müssen, gehört die Verwaltung aller Server, um deren Verhalten, Stabilität und Auslastung kontinuierlich zu überwachen, und obwohl es viele Tools gibt, die wir für die Verwaltung und Überwachung des Servers verwenden können wird ein einfaches, leistungsstarkes Werkzeug sehen, das zweifellos eine große Hilfe bei der administrativen Aufgabe sein wird, die wir haben: Webmin. Für diese Studie verwenden wir eine Umgebung CentOS 7.

Was ist WebminWebmin ist eine Webschnittstelle, die uns die Möglichkeit gibt, verschiedene Parameter unserer Server zu verwalten und von der aus wir Verwaltungsaufgaben wie:

  • Kontenverwaltung des Benutzers.
  • Aufbau Apache.
  • DNS-Konfiguration.
  • Geben Sie Dateien zwischen Windows-Systemen mit Samba frei.
  • Gründen Festplattenkontingente.
  • Legen Sie unter anderem Firewall-Einstellungen fest.
  • Webmin-Anwendungen basieren auf dem Perlenmodule und sie benutzen die TCP-Port 10000 mit einem OpenSSL-Bibliothek für den gesamten Web-Kommunikationsprozess, der uns mehr Sicherheit und Zuverlässigkeit bietet.

Webmin-kompatible BetriebssystemeEinige der von Webmin unterstützten Betriebssysteme sind:

  • TurboLinux
  • Ubuntu-Linux
  • United Linux
  • Weißer Zwerg Linux
  • Whitebox-Linux
  • Wind River Linux
  • Fenster
  • X / OS Linux
  • Xandros Linux
  • XenServer Linux
  • Gelber Hund Linux
  • Yoper Linux
  • Mac OS X
  • Linux Mint
  • Debian
  • CentOS

NotizUm mehr über dieses großartige Tool zu erfahren, können wir den folgenden Link besuchen, wo wir ein Wiki mit finden alles rund um Webmin:

1. Erstellen Sie das Repository und installieren Sie Webmin


Schritt 1
Der erste Schritt, der empfohlen wird, besteht darin, unser eigenes Repository zu erstellen, in dem wir alle mit Webmin verbundenen Informationen speichern müssen. Dazu erstellen wir ein Repository namens webmin.repo und wir werden den folgenden Befehl für diesen Prozess verwenden:
 sudo nano /etc/yum.repos.d/webmin.repo
Schritt 2
Wir können sehen, dass wir beim Zugriff eine leere Datei haben, wir müssen der Datei Folgendes hinzufügen:
 [Webmin] name = Webmin Distribution Neutral # baseurl = http: //download.webmin.com/download/yum mirrorlist = http: //download.webmin.com/download/yum/mirrorlist aktiviert = 1

Schritt 3
Wir speichern die Änderungen mit der Tastenkombination

Strg + ODER

und wir verlassen den Editor mit der Kombination

Strg + x

NotizDiese Kombination gilt, wenn wir verwenden nano als Editor, wenn wir vi verwenden, ist der Prozess anders.

Schritt 4
Sobald dieser Vorgang abgeschlossen ist, laden wir einen .asc-Schlüssel herunter und importieren ihn mit RPM.
Dazu verwenden wir den folgenden Befehl:

 sudo wget http://www.webmin.com/jcameron-key.asc

Schritt 5
Später verwenden wir für den Import folgenden Befehl:

 sudo rpm --import jcameron-key.asc
Schritt 6
Wenn alles oben konfiguriert ist, installieren wir Webmin mit dem folgenden Befehl:
 sudo yum installiere webmin

Schritt 7
Wir hoffen, dass alle Pakete heruntergeladen und installiert wurden.

Schritt 8
Falls wir die Firewall in CentOS 7 verwenden, müssen wir eine Regel hinzufügen, damit der Webmin-Kommunikationsport aktiviert ist. Denken Sie daran, dass der Standardport 10000 ist. Dazu müssen wir die Datei bearbeiten iptables mit dem gewünschten Editor verwenden wir für diesen Fall nano und geben Folgendes ein:

 sudo nano / etc / sysconfig / iptables
Schritt 9
Im angezeigten Fenster fügen wir die folgende Zeile hinzu:
 -A EINGANG -p tcp -m tcp --dport 10000 -j AKZEPTIEREN

Schritt 10
Wir speichern die Änderungen wie zuvor gesehen und verlassen den Editor. Es ist notwendig, den Dienst neu zu starten, da wir Änderungen in einer Konfigurationsdatei vornehmen, dazu verwenden wir den Befehl:

 Dienst iptables neu starten

2. Zugriff auf Webmin unter CentOS 7


Schritt 1
Um auf Webmin zuzugreifen, müssen wir zu einem Browser gehen und die folgende Syntax eingeben:
 http: // IP_Adresse: 10000
Schritt 2
Um die IP unserer CentOS 7-Geräte zu sehen, können wir den Befehl verwenden ifconfig oder IP-Adresse, in unserem Fall ist die IP 192.168.0.68, für die wir die Route eingeben;
 http://192.168.0.38:1000
Schritt 3
Im angezeigten Fenster müssen wir Root-Zugangsdaten eingeben unseres Teams.

Schritt 4
Wir drücken Anmeldung um auf die Webmin-Webkonsole zuzugreifen, und wir werden Folgendes beachten.

Schritt 5
Ab diesem Zeitpunkt haben wir die Möglichkeit, verschiedene Serverparameter zu verwalten, wie zum Beispiel:

  • System
  • Dienstleistungen
  • Cluster
  • Hardware
  • Benutzer usw.

Im Hauptfenster sehen wir die gesamte aktuelle Systemkonfiguration, wie verfügbarer Speicher, virtueller Speicher, Prozessortyp, Webmin-Version usw.

3. Webmin-Optionen in CentOS 7


Wenn wir auf die Konsole zugreifen, haben wir viele Optionen, alle sehr nützlich für Teammanagement und Benutzer werden wir einige der wichtigsten analysieren.

SystemVon dieser Registerkarte aus können wir verschiedene Aufgaben im Zusammenhang mit dem System Was:

  • Betrachten welche Dienste laufen aktuell und welche starten am Anfang des Logins
  • Passwörter ändern
  • Betrachten Scheiben und Quotes von Festplatten
  • Betrachten Benutzer und Gruppen
  • Aufgaben planen, etc

ServerVon dieser Registerkarte haben wir die Möglichkeit zu sehen Welche Rollen erfüllt unser Server CentOS 7 und verwalten sie von hier aus, wir können Rollen verwalten wie:

  • SSH
  • Sendmail
  • Postfix
  • Apache usw.

AndereVon dieser Option haben wir zusätzliche Werkzeuge für die Serververwaltung wie Login über SSH, Java-Dateiverwaltung, Dateiverwaltung usw.

VernetzungMit dieser Option haben wir die gesamte Verwaltung der Netzwerkparameter des CentOS 7-Servers wie:

  • Aktivieren und konfigurieren Firewall
  • Verwaltung von IPv4 und IPv6
  • Überwachung Bandbreite
  • Verwaltung von Netzwerkparameter, etc.

HardwareDurch diese Option haben wir Zugriff auf Parameter verwalten Was:

  • Festplatte
  • Volumen
  • Systemzeit
  • Partitionen usw.

ClusterDurch diese Option haben wir alle Möglichkeiten von Clustermanagement Was:

  • Kopieren von Dateien
  • Erstellung von Cluster
  • Benutzer und GruppeCluster
  • Shell-Befehle für Cluster, unter anderem.

Unbenutzte ModuleEs bezieht sich auf einige Module, die bereits in Einstellung durch Webmin sie bleiben aber weiterhin für das Management verfügbar.

Da wir mit Webmin analysieren konnten, haben wir eine komplett komplette Plattform voller Optionen für die Rollen, die wir als IT- und Support-Personal erfüllen. Mit diesem Tool haben Sie auf grafische und einfache Weise alle notwendigen Konfigurationen für Ihre Server unter Linux. Wenn Sie Administrator eines CentOS-Servers sind oder einen einrichten möchten, dann geht es los So erstellen und konfigurieren Sie einen Server in CentOS ganz und gar.

CentOS DHCP-Server

wave wave wave wave wave